This refers to the editorial "Lessons from two elections" (December 24). With a stable and one-party government, let us hope that Jharkhand, the mineral-rich state that has been exploited by corrupt and mean politicians, will prosper. The state's mineral wealth should not be in the control of greedy politicians. Instead, it should be used for the betterment of the state and the country. Although we cannot deny a Modi wave in both Jharkhand and Jammu & Kashmir, the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) should not take this victory for granted. More than a Modi wave, the current mandate reflects the people's anger against corrupt and non-performing governments and their aspiration for development and economic growth.

Despite the tall promises, the BJP failed to make inroads into Kashmir, which proves that the people of the valley still do not trust the Modi government. Nevertheless , the BJP should rise above petty politics and try to form the government in alliance with the Peoples Democratic Party and work for the betterment of the people of Kashmir.
